Myth/Fact: The quality isn't as good as vent.
Reality: In the past the CGA/TOJ ts server was hosted on a home internet connection. This severely limited the amount of bandwidth available. The current ts server resides on the same machine as the cga website. It's a dual processor mahcine hooked up to a 10 megabit dedicated connection in a datacenter. The TS server now has the 25 kilobit option enabled for all channels if you want it. It still may not be as good as vent..but you don't sound like a tin can either. If you do find somebody with a CA by their name(that a channel admin) or SA(server admin) and they can raise the room's codec to the 25 kilobit level for you.

Myth: TS is unstable.
Fact: The servers ts was operated on were unstable. The current machine does not go offline except for maintenance runs or severe issues at the data center. The data center has not had any issues affecting the server except for once and we were warned in advance.

Myth: TS can't handle more than 20 people
Fact: TS can handle hundreds depending on hardware and bandwidth availability. With 100 slots we will use no more than 4-5 megabits of our bandwidth. The CGA site doesn't use even 500 kilobits of bandwidth so we have plenty to spare. The cga website right now doesn't even make the server realize it is there. Linux uses load ratings to determine the work the system is doing. A load of 2 would (roughly) signify both cpus are at 100% utilization all the time. Right now the server load averages .08.

actually gsm isn't the best..


  1. Speex 16.3 Kbit- Normal
  2. GSM 16.4 Kbit - about the same as above
  3. Speex 19.5 Kbit- Better
  4. Speex 25.9 Kbit- best
GSM's quality is debatable. I made it available due to some folks saying it sounds better than speex. speex though have better quality and use less cpu than gsm does.
